Pros and Cons of Metal Roof
Metal roofing offers an engaging mix of toughness and power performance, making it a prominent choice among home owners. One considerable benefit is its long life-span; metal roof coverings can last half a century or more with proper upkeep.
They're likewise resistant to severe weather, consisting of heavy snow, rainfall, and wind. Additionally, metal shows sunlight, which helps reduce cooling expenses in warm climates.
Nevertheless, there are some downsides to consider. Steel roofing can be more costly ahead of time contrasted to traditional products, which could stress your budget plan.
Installation can additionally be tricky, requiring proficient experts to guarantee an appropriate fit and seal. If you live in a noisy area, you could locate that during hefty rain or hailstorm, the sound can be enhanced, potentially disturbing your peace.
Another point to think of is the aesthetic selection. While metal roofings been available in different designs and shades, they mightn't fit every building style.
If you're looking for that traditional appearance, you may feel steel isn't the very best fit.
Inevitably, evaluating these advantages and disadvantages will certainly assist you make a decision if metal roof covering straightens with your needs and preferences for your home.
Advantages and disadvantages of Asphalt Tiles
Asphalt shingles are one of one of the most preferred roofing materials for house owners because of their cost and convenience of installation. They can be found in a selection of shades and designs, permitting you to match your home's aesthetic.
One of the biggest benefits is the expense; asphalt tiles are typically more economical than various other roof covering materials. Their installment is straightforward, making it quick and hassle-free for specialists to put them on your roofing.
However, there are some downsides to take into consideration. Asphalt roof shingles commonly have a much shorter lifespan, balancing around 15 to thirty years, depending on the top quality.
